primary key與unique的區別


primary key與unique的區別
  1. primary key = unique + not null 主鍵不能為空每個字段值都不重復,unique可以為空,非空字段不重復
  2. unique 一個或者多個字段定義,primary key 單字段主鍵或多字段聯合主鍵
  3. primary key一個表只能有一個,unique一個表可以有多個
  4. 邏輯設計上primary key用來作記錄標識,unique用來保證唯一性,但是在他們創建時都會去相應創建一個unique index,可以用來做sql優化。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M